Home siding replacement services involve removing existing exterior siding and installing new materials to improve the appearance, durability, and energy efficiency of a property. This process typically begins with an assessment of the current siding condition, followed by careful removal of damaged or outdated panels. The new siding is then installed according to manufacturer specifications, ensuring a tight fit that helps protect the home from weather elements. Homeowners seeking this service often look for a way to update the look of their property while also addressing underlying issues that may have developed over time.

Siding replacement is a practical solution for a variety of problems, including rotting, warping, cracking, or extensive damage caused by weather exposure. Over time, siding can become faded or stained, diminishing curb appeal. It can also develop gaps or holes that compromise insulation and lead to higher energy costs. Replacing worn or damaged siding helps prevent further deterioration, reduces the risk of water infiltration, and maintains the structural integrity of the home. This service is especially valuable for homeowners noticing increased drafts, moisture issues, or visible signs of aging on their exterior walls.

Properties that typically undergo siding replacement include older homes with original siding materials, homes that have experienced storm damage, or those seeking a fresh aesthetic update. Residential properties of all sizes, from single-family houses to multi-unit buildings, may require siding upgrades to meet their needs. New construction projects might also involve siding installation, but the focus here is on replacing existing materials. Whether a home is made of wood, vinyl, fiber cement, or other siding types, local service providers can help determine the best options for durability and style, tailored to the specific property.

The overview below groups typical Home Siding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Ellensburg,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Minor siding repairs or replacements for small sections typically range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for simple fixes or partial panel replacements. Larger or more complex repairs can exceed this range, depending on material and scope.

Standard Siding Replacement - Replacing siding on an average-sized home usually costs between $5,000 and $15,000. Most projects in this category are straightforward and fall in the middle of this range, with fewer reaching into the higher end for premium materials or extensive work.

Full Home Siding Replacement - Complete siding overhauls for larger homes can range from $15,000 to $30,000 or more. These larger projects tend to be more complex, but many local contractors can complete typical replacements within the mid to upper part of this range.

High-End or Custom Projects - Custom or premium siding installations, especially on larger or architecturally unique homes, can reach $30,000+ in costs. Such projects are less common and often involve high-end materials or detailed craftsmanship, influencing the overall price.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of replacing home siding? Replacing home siding can improve curb appeal, enhance energy efficiency, and increase the overall value of a property by updating its exterior appearance and protection.

How do I know if my home needs siding replacement? Signs that siding may need replacing include visible damage, warping, cracking, or significant wear that affects the home's exterior integrity.

What types of siding materials are available for replacement? Common siding options include vinyl, fiber cement, wood, and metal, each offering different aesthetics and durability levels.

Can replacing siding help improve home insulation? Yes, new siding can provide better insulation properties, potentially reducing energy costs and making indoor spaces more comfortable.
